1
Well hi there, fancy meeting you here.
Mock-coincidence delight.
2
Hey, hope you're doing well.
Casual, friendly check-in opener.
3
Hi! You caught me mid-snack, but hi.
Casual self-deprecation.
4
Hello, is it me you're looking for?
Lionel Richie reference; flirty-funny.
5
Hello, lovely to hear from you.
Delighted tone for messages.
6
Ahoy-hoy, like a fancy telephone.
Alexander Graham Bell nostalgia.
7
Hey! Long time no everything.
Joking about lost touch.
8
Greetings, earthling.
Sci-fi playfulness for nerdy friends.
9
Hi there, how are you?
Warm, caring everyday greeting.
10
Hello from the other side — of the room.
Adele reference; playful and musical.
11
Hi! You've reached the world's okayest person.
Self-deprecating opener; disarming.
12
Hey! Nice of you to summon me.
Playful sarcasm.

How to Choose the Right Alternative

  1. Avoid sarcastic or funny alternatives in serious conversations. Tone misfires are hard to unsend.
  2. Match the register to the reader: professional for work, casual for friends, flirty only where it is clearly welcome.
  3. Adjust one word to make it yours: swap a name, a detail, or a reference only the two of you share.
  4. For texts, shorter is almost always better. Trim any alternative that takes more than one breath to say.
  5. In emails, pair a formal opening alternative with a warm closing one to sound polished but human.
